What the numbers show
Economic Outlook No 116 — Employment coefficient is currently reported for 24 countries. The highest value is 1.75 in Luxembourg; the lowest is 0.9846 in Belgium.
The median across all reporting countries is 1.05, and the mean is 1.08.
The gap between the highest and lowest reporting country is a factor of about 2.
Over the past decade 15 countries rose and 8 fell. The largest increase was in Luxembourg (up 4.6%), and the largest decrease in Greece (down 5.6%).

About this data
The OECD Economic Outlook presents the OECD’s analysis of the major global economic trends and prospects for the next two years. The Outlook puts forward a consistent set of projections for output, employment, government spending, prices and current balances based on a review of each member country and of the induced effect on each of them on international developments.
